Surpassing the expectations formed at the en primeur stage, the 2023 La Mission Haut-Brion unfurls in the glass with aromas of cassis, dark berries, spices, licorice, burning embers and pencil shavings. Medium- to full-bodied, ample and velvety, it is suave and seamless, built around a perfectly controlled, dense core of fruit framed by powdery, structuring tannins and lively acidity, extending into a long, seemingly endless and ethereal finish. The blend comprises 52.7% Merlot, 29.6% Cabernet Sauvignon and 17.7% Cabernet Franc.

Aromatically explosive and nuanced, the 2023 La Mission Haut-Brion is magnificent. It's silky, nuanced and exceptionally polished. I underestimated it from barrel. The blend includes 17% Cabernet Franc, among the highest ever here, and that comes through in the wine's explosiveness. The 2023 has come along beautifully over the last few years. What a fabulous surprise.
Absolute classic La Mission sexiness and opulence emerge from the 2023 Château La Mission Haut-Brion, a blend of ripe red and black currants, flowery incense, spice, tobacco, and subtle smoky notes. It's medium to full-bodied, with a pure, layered, graceful mouthfeel, sweet tannins, and outstanding length. This deep, rich, multi-dimensional La Mission will shine with just 4-5 years of bottle age and cruise for 30+ years.
